What is an SWS?

SWS stands for Social Welfare Services, which are professionals who provide support and assistance to individuals and families in need. Their primary goal is to improve social functioning and quality of life by connecting clients with resources, offering counseling, and advocating for their rights. SWS workers often collaborate with government agencies, non-profits, and community organizations to address issues such as poverty, abuse, and mental health challenges. They play a crucial role in ensuring vulnerable populations receive the help and support they need.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a social worker,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Social Worker, you need a solid understanding of social work principles, case management, and typically a bachelor's or master's degree in social work (BSW/MSW) with appropriate state licensure. Familiarity with case management software, documentation systems, and knowledge of local community resources are important technical tools. Strong interpersonal skills, empathy, active listening, and resilience help you build trust and advocate for clients effectively. These skills and qualities are essential for providing meaningful support, navigating complex situations, and making a positive impact on individuals and communities.

Job description

Purpose and Mission

The Finance Director SWS Americas will be responsible for all financial management and accounting activities across SWS Americas (USA & Colombia).

The successful candidate will be an integral part of the Americas senior management team, identifying opportunities and risks and helping formulate the region’s plans to deliver the strategy & business growth objectives. These include analyzing costs of materials, processes, and labor to determine methods of optimizing costs and expanding value to our customers. This position plays a critical role in ensuring strong financial governance, delivering accurate insights, and supporting strategic decision-making across SWS Americas.

Key Activities and Responsibilities
  • Lead and develop a high-performing finance team, providing clear direction, coaching, and succession planning.
  • Drive financial planning, forecasting, and budgeting processes, ensuring alignment with business strategy.
  • Oversee monthly close and reporting, delivering accurate, timely, and insightful financial analysis.
  • Provide actionable items which can improve the financial performance of the Business Unit and Region.
  • Work with other Regional Finance Directors to ensure alignment on Global goals of the Business Unit.
  • Act as a strategic business partner to senior leadership, influencing decisions through data-driven insights.
  • Ensure compliance with US GAAP, internal policies, and regulatory requirements.
  • Lead internal and external audits and manage relationships with auditors and tax advisors.
  • Optimize working capital, cash flow, and financial performance across the business.
  • Evaluate and approve capital investments aligned with strategic objectives.
  • Drive continuous improvement and finance transformation initiatives, leveraging systems such as SAP.
  • Promote a culture of accountability, collaboration, and continuous improvement.
  • Perform ad‑hoc analytics as required to drive the business.
